- #include "toolchain/check/context.h"
- #include "toolchain/check/convert.h"
- #include "toolchain/parse/node_kind.h"
- namespace Carbon::Check {
- auto HandleArrayExprStart(Context& /*context*/,
- Parse::ArrayExprStartId /*parse_node*/) -> bool {
- return true;
- }
- auto HandleArrayExprSemi(Context& context, Parse::ArrayExprSemiId parse_node)
- -> bool {
- context.node_stack().Push(parse_node);
- return true;
- }
- auto HandleArrayExpr(Context& context, Parse::ArrayExprId parse_node) -> bool {
- // TODO: Handle array type with undefined bound.
- if (context.node_stack()
- .PopAndDiscardSoloParseNodeIf<Parse::NodeKind::ArrayExprSemi>()) {
- context.node_stack().PopAndIgnore();
- return context.TODO(parse_node, "HandleArrayExprWithoutBounds");
- }
- auto bound_inst_id = context.node_stack().PopExpr();
- context.node_stack()
- .PopAndDiscardSoloParseNode<Parse::NodeKind::ArrayExprSemi>();
- auto [element_type_node_id, element_type_inst_id] =
- context.node_stack().PopExprWithParseNode();
- // The array bound must be a constant.
- //
- // TODO: Should we support runtime-phase bounds in cases such as:
- // comptime fn F(n: i32) -> type { return [i32; n]; }
- auto bound_inst = context.constant_values().Get(bound_inst_id);
- if (!bound_inst.is_constant()) {
- CARBON_DIAGNOSTIC(InvalidArrayExpr, Error,
- "Array bound is not a constant.");
- context.emitter().Emit(bound_inst_id, InvalidArrayExpr);
- context.node_stack().Push(parse_node, SemIR::InstId::BuiltinError);
- return true;
- }
- context.AddInstAndPush(
- {parse_node, SemIR::ArrayType{SemIR::TypeId::TypeType, bound_inst_id,
- ExprAsType(context, element_type_node_id,
- element_type_inst_id)}});
- return true;
- }
- } // namespace Carbon::Check
